Marie D Krings

July 14, 1926 — November 30, 2023

Marie D. Krings, 97, of Humphrey passed away peacefully on November 30, 2023 at Brookstone Acres in Columbus, NE.

Mass of Christian burial will be 10:30 a.m., Saturday, December 9, 2023 at St. Michael's Catholic Church in Tarnov, NE.  Visitation will be Friday, December 8, 2023 at St. Michael's Catholic Church beginning at 4 p.m. with a service at 7 p.m.  Visitation will resume at 9:30 a.m. Saturday morning prior to the funeral service.  McKown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.

Marie Dorothy Krings, daughter of Frank and Mary (Shotkoski) Torczon was born on July 14, 1926 at her childhood home in rural Tarnov.  She was one of eight children, brothers Eddie, Alex, Don and Dave and sisters Edomina, Betty and Norma.  She attended first grade in Krakow, NE where she lived one year with her grandparents and then attended second through eighth grade at rural District 60 near St. Anthony's Catholic Church.

Marie was united in marriage to Emil Krings on November 27, 1945 at St. Anthony's Catholic Church. They lived and farmed southwest of Tarnov until 1999 when they retired to Humphrey.  They grew up as neighbors and began dating in their early teens.  Neither one dated anyone else.  They were married 67 years before Emil passed away in 2013, and they raised five children, JoAnn, Darlene, Richard, John & Julie.  Marie was the glue that held the family together following Emil's death.

Marie was a member of St. Anthony's Catholic Church where she was involved in Altar Society.  After the closing of St. Anthony's, she became a member of St. Michael's Catholic Church in Tarnov.  She had a wonderful sense of humor that she acquired from her Dad, and she loved jokes and funny greeting cards.   She was a great encourager, full of love and always willing to extend grace to others.  She enjoyed life and was always ready for a card game or trip to the casino.  She was an excellent cook, baker and seamstress, and she made the best fried chicken.  Having grown up during the depression, she saved and reused every container that was brought into the house.  When you opened the refrigerator and grabbed a container, you never knew if you were getting Cool Whip, butter or leftover goulash!  Through her example and teaching, her kids learned many skills such as canning, baking, cooking, and butchering chickens.  She loved being a housewife, mother and grandmother and was happiest when she was taking care of her family.  Her kids described her as the perfect mom!  As she recently looked back on her life, she said she had no regrets.

Marie was a faithful follower of Jesus Christ her entire life.  She renewed her commitment to Christ in late 2019 and accepted his gift of eternal salvation through faith in Jesus Christ as promised in Ephesians.  She lived her life as a powerful example of unconditional love.
